Figure 7-4 shows installation details for a two-wire level transmitter that is
powered through the control system analog input card. Also, connections
are shown between the control system analog output card and an I/P
transducer and pneumatic valve actuator. Details such as the 20 psi air
supply to the I/P and the 60 psi air supply to the actuator are shown on
this drawing. Based on information provided by the loop diagram, we
know that the I/P will be calibrated to provide a 3–15 psi signal to the
valve actuator. In addition, specific details are provided on the level mea-
surement installation. Since the installation shows sensing lines to the top
and bottom of the tank, it becomes clear that the tank is pressurized and
that level will be sensed based on the differential pressure.
